The authors profiled differentially expressed microRNAs between parental adherent breast cancer cells and breast cancer stem cell (BCSC) -mimicking mammospheres, and identified hsa-miR-27a as a negative regulator for survival and chemoresistance of BCSCs by downregulating genes essential for detoxification of ROS and impairing of autophagy. Enhancement of the hsa-miR-27a signaling pathway may be a potential therapeutic modality for breast cancer.
